Some say ‘burden’. Others say ‘opportunity’. Here are three areas where telehealth can grow. Prior to The COVID outbreak of 2019/2020, lack of awareness was a major concern for telehealth. Well, all that has changed; a survey of 2,000 Americans conducted by Sykes in late March 2020 showed that:  73% of Americans would consider using telehealth for COVID screening.  60% knew if their provider offered telehealth services. Only 3% would not consider a telehealth appointment....

Millions of IVF babies have been born through IVF, but a significant number of cycles still fail our patients. There is a lot of room for improvement in infertility healthcare, among them are, to get patients pregnant faster, reduce treatment “dropout”, and reduce embryo “wastage” and more. Artificial intelligence (AI) has the potential to enhance our diagnostic and prognostic capabilities, minimize variability and error, and maximize precision and speed of IVF treatment.
